Core Technology & Products
The company's KS Series Diffuser represents a breakthrough in pneumatic process stability through precision vacuum sintering technology. Constructed from food-grade 304/316L stainless steel, the diffuser features customizable pore sizes ranging from 0.1-120μm, enabling uniform dispersion of gas or liquid media. The precision-engineered pore distribution significantly increases media contact area, improving dispersion efficiency while maintaining low flow resistance.

TOP 3: Evoqua Water Technologies
Evoqua specializes in water and wastewater treatment diffuser systems, with fine bubble diffusers designed for municipal and industrial applications. Their products focus on oxygen transfer efficiency and energy savings in biological treatment processes. The company provides comprehensive system design and optimization services.
TOP 4: Xylem Inc.
Xylem's diffuser portfolio emphasizes durability and long-term performance in demanding wastewater treatment environments. Their membrane diffuser technology delivers consistent bubble size distribution, supporting stable biological processes. The company offers extensive technical support and performance guarantees.
TOP 5: Parkson Corporation
Parkson provides coarse and fine bubble diffuser systems for water treatment applications, with emphasis on ease of maintenance and operational flexibility. Their solutions integrate with complete aeration system designs, offering turnkey installation options for municipal and industrial clients.
TOP 6: SSI Aeration
SSI Aeration focuses on energy-efficient diffuser technology for wastewater treatment, with proprietary designs that minimize pressure loss and maximize oxygen transfer. Their products feature modular construction for simplified installation and maintenance, backed by comprehensive performance testing data.
TOP 7: Sanitaire (Xylem Brand)
Sanitaire offers a comprehensive range of ceramic and membrane diffusers for municipal wastewater treatment, with decades of field-proven performance. Their systems emphasize reliability and low lifecycle costs, supported by extensive application engineering resources and global service capabilities.
Conclusion & Recommendations
Selecting the appropriate air diffuser for pneumatic process stability requires careful evaluation of application-specific requirements including media characteristics, pressure and temperature conditions, material compatibility, and maintenance accessibility. Industrial operators should prioritize solutions that offer documented performance data, comprehensive technical support, and proven reliability in similar applications. Customization capabilities and compliance with relevant industry standards (ISO, FDA, GMP) are essential considerations for regulated industries. Engaging with suppliers early in the design phase enables optimization of diffuser specifications to match process requirements, ultimately delivering improved stability, reduced energy consumption, and lower total cost of ownership.
